Transaction 87bee3d82a23253999f5952f60efbd4e2f4e3216ca7138851e44a6f004e80858
1 Input
1 Output
-
87bee3d82a23253999f5952f60efbd4e2f4e3216ca7138851e44a6f004e80858:0
- value
- 21580
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9136c6356bdcd77b87a2df8054036e9cdf42e76
- address
- bc1qmyfkcc6khhxh0wr69huq2spka8xlgtnku358ku